Our School

Opening its doors in 2001, Ryan Park Elementary is one of four elementary schools in the MSD of Steuben County, serving approximately 400 students in grades K-5. Ryan Park is a "bus-in" school with a vast majority of the students residing in rural areas of Steuben County. Steuben County borders the Michigan state line to the north and the Ohio state line to the east with Angola as the county seat. 

Ryan Park is accredited through the Indiana Department of Education. Our school improvement goal focuses on improving in the areas of reading and math as measured by the statewide ILEARN annual test. Professional development is offered and encouraged for every staff member to model life-long learning.

Our school has participated in the development and implementation of a district-wide curriculum based on the Indiana Standards in English/Language Arts, mathematics, science, and social studies as well as other age appropriate curriculum across the grade levels. Our curriculum is reviewed annually for changes and supporting resources using previous spring assessment data. In order to best meet the needs of our students, Ryan Park staff uses data from a number of quality assessments to drive instruction. Academic programming includes "Multi-Tier System of Support" levels beginning with classroom differentiation within the regular classroom moving to small group and individual instruction during scheduled periods of the day.
